Michigan gas prices drop 11 cents this week, AAA reports

Average gas prices in Michigan dropped 11 cents this week, AAA-The Auto Club reported. Michigan drivers are now paying an average of $3.12 per gallon for regular unleaded. This price is 8 cents less than this time last month and 36 cents less than this time last year. That adds up to about $46 for a 15-gallon tank of gasoline. Compared to last week, Metro Detroit's average daily gas price decreased. Metro Detroit's current average is $3.18 per gallon, about 3 cents less than last week's average and 36 cents less than this same time last year. The most expensive gas price averages in Michigan this week were: Ann Arbor ($3.22), Metro Detroit ($3.18) and Jackson ($3.13). The least expensive gas price averages in Michigan this week were: Marquette ($3.04), Grand Rapids ($3.07) and Flint ($3.07).

Florida gas prices dip more than a dime in a week. Here's what you'll pay at the pump.

There was good news at the pump for Florida drivers last week as gas prices dropped more than a dime. On Monday, drivers were paying an average of $2.94 a gallon for regular unleaded, down from $3.09 a week earlier, according to the AAA auto club. For several months, average prices in Florida had been moving about 15 cents a week in both directions until holding around $3.10 a gallon during the last two weeks. Nationally, the average price Monday was $3.15 a gallon, up a penny from a week earlier. Patrick De Haan, head of petroleum analysis at GasBuddy, said prices could dip before Labor Day. "Oil prices continue to hover in the mid-to-upper $60s (a barrel), and with gasoline demand starting to ease as we head into August, we could see prices gradually decline as we approach Labor Day," De Haan posted online. "That said, this is also the time of year when the tropics begin to stir, so we'll be keeping a close eye on hurricane activity that could disrupt supply and shift the outlook." In Miami-Dade on Monday, the average price for regular unleaded was $2.95 a gallon, down 11 cents from the week before. A month ago, the average was $3.09 and a year ago drivers were paying $3.45 a gallon. In Broward, the average was also $2.95 a gallon, down 16 cents from last week. A month ago, the average was $3.14 and a year ago it was $3.49 a gallon. Gas prices in Michigan decline about 10 cents a gallon

Gas prices in Michigan are down about 10 cents a gallon as compared to a week ago, AAA-The Auto Club Group reported. Michigan drivers are now paying an average of $3.13 per gallon for regular unleaded, the weekly report says. This price is 6 cents less than this time last month and 56 cents less than this time last year. For a 15-gallon tank of gas, that adds up to a fill-up cost of about $46. Compared to last week, Metro Detroit's average daily gas price decreased slightly. Metro Detroit's current average is $3.19 per gallon, about 2 cents less than last week's average and 50 cents less than this same time last year.

Gas prices in Michigan up 8 cents this week, AAA reports

Gas prices in Michigan are up 8 cents this week, with motorists paying an average $3.23 per gallon for regular unleaded gasoline, AAA-The Auto Club reported. This price is 7 cents less than this time last month, and 56 cents less than this time last year. For a 15-gallon tank of gas, that adds up to about $48. The most expensive gas price averages reported this week were in Grand Rapids ($3.30), Ann Arbor ($3.27) and Jackson ($3.25). The least expensive gas price averages reported this week were in Marquette ($3.02), Traverse City ($3.16) and Metro Detroit ($3.21).
